The most recent. That’s robert stack as eliot ness in -the scarface mob-. On the latest there had been some mafia movies and documentaries that i saw and not to forget the game by illusion software: MAFIA, which I had just finished.

After drawing jennifer lopez and some other portraits (not published yet), skepticism arose that maybe these hands are just good at faces and hair. Thus a full figure was tried and the result is right here. The face is not important here but everything else is: drapes behind, the floor, carpets, the door and of course the tuxedo.

great drawing.. if I can be bit critical.. U could play bit more with details.. but it's ok.Just something on shading didn't fit to me here.. I looked on it and saw it.. You have shades like you have background one thing, than some transparent layer with shades of figure and than figure. It's best seen on shade of leg, which stands on ground.. shade should be curved by ground... And not just after person, because there's bend, where ground becomes to wall and shade should be curved and more on ground I think.. U know what I mean?
